When people think of running a business, they dream of making a lot of money, traveling the world, and working less. According to host May Yeo Silvers, this is known as the CEO mindset. While it is entirely possible to achieve this lifestyle, there are many things an entrepreneur must do before they get to that place. In today’s episode, May discusses the distinction between a CEO mindset and an employee mindset. 

According to May, the first step to running a successful company is letting go of your employee mindset. To do this, May explains that you need to focus on investing in your business and be willing to always take that extra step. In reality, being a CEO comes with many more risks than being an employee. As a CEO, you are responsible for the outcome of every decision you make. So when deciding whether or not you want to open a business, it is important to first understand what it means to be a CEO.

Tune into this week’s episode of The Unstoppable Eventrepreneur™ to learn more about the difference between a business owner and a CEO, the importance of investing in your business, and how to use your ‘why’ to transform you from an employee into a powerful and successful CEO. 

 

Quotes

• “When you own a business and you know how to run your business, your business is profitable, and your business can run without you, you certainly can enjoy the fruits of your labor where you make a lot of money and work very little.” (05:01-05:13)

• “As a CEO, you are the only person. You have to make all of the decisions and you have to go figure things out.” (07:32-07:39)

• “In order for your business or your side hustle to become a full-time job, you have got to stop thinking like an employee.” (12:54-13:00)

• “A CEO is up for challenges. A CEO loves the potential for great results and they're not afraid to fail.”  (15:58-16:08)
